Mercer International Inc., together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ells northern bleached softwood kraft (NBSK) pulp in the United States, Germany, China, and internationally.

The company operates through two segments, Pulp and Solid Wood. It also generates and sells green energy produced from biomass cogeneration power plant to third party.

In addition, the company manufactures, distributes, and sells lumber, cross-laminated timber, finger joint lumber, wood pallets, electricity, biofuels, and wood residuals.

Further, it produces NBSK pulp primarily from wood chips, pulp logs, and sawlogs; carbon neutral or green energy using carbon-neutral biofuels, such as black liquor and wood waste; and tall oil for use as a chemical additive and green energy source.

In addition, it provides transportation and logistics services. The company sells its pulp to market pulp, integrated paper, and paperboard manufacturers; and lumber products to distributors, construction firms, secondary manufacturers, retail yards, and home centers.

Mercer International Inc. was founded in 1968 and is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.
